    Justin; have you ruled out the possibility that the TV may be re-sampling the digital signal.

    My TV (not a Samsung btw) does. Just a thought
    Totally.

    I hardly listen to anything but 44.1KHz stuff via TIDAL these days, so it doesn't really matter.

    The distance from my laptop to the DAC is more than 5 metres, more than the USB spec. TBH that still works and it probably should sound better than the method I use. However, in practise the via the TV link never fails or glitches unless TIDAL servers fail to deliver. I have less trouble with it than the USB link.

    Occasionally I get the USB lead out for high bit rate stuff but it never lasts long.
